The deterioration in financial results is explained by an increase in the volume of transportation of low-margin cargoes, such as iron and manganese ore (65% compared to July 2023).
It is noted that the income from the transportation of these goods does not return the costs of their organization.
In July 2024, 13.6 million tons of cargo were transported, which is 12% more than last year: in domestic traffic – 6.4 million tons (-22% compared to July 2023); for export – 6.4 million tons (+93% in July 2023); for import – 746,000 tons (+39% in July 2023).
SA Ukrzaliznytsia They believe that the situation can be improved by approaching the cost of transportation of goods of different types of tariffs.
“There is no economic justification for having a large difference in the cost of transportation of goods of different tariff classes, because the infrastructure component (infrastructure maintenance costs) is the same for all goods, ” said the statement.
We remind you that in January-June 2024 Ukrzaliznytsia carried more than 90 million tons of cargo, which is 28% more than the same period in 2023, in particular, the volume of export traffic has increased significantly.
